Original title:
Návrh databáze letokruhových chronologií
Translated title:
Design of a dendrochronological database
Authors:
Majer, Hugo-Miroslav ; Brůha, Lukáš (advisor) ; Brodský, Lukáš (referee) Document type: Bachelor's theses
Year:
2021
Language:
slo Abstract:
[eng][cze] The bachelor thesis focuses on the design of a spatial database of tree-ring chronologies. The theoretical part of the thesis describes database systems and the storage of spatial data in relational databases. It also reviews existing databases of tree-ring chronologies and the basics of dendrochronology. The next section describes provided dendrochronological data, which are used in methodical section of the thesis. The methodical section describes the data requirements for the created database, the process of its design and implementation within PostgreSQL/PostGIS. Subsequently, it deals with the creation of functions developed in procedural extension of SQL. The stored functions are used to improve import of data. Afterwards, the design of a data filter in the form of SQL statement is mentioned. The main result of the thesis is a spatial database that meets both data and functional requirements, contains provided data and is connectable to GIS. The thesis concludes with a summary of the achieved results and contributions to the ongoing scientific project. Keywords: spatial database, database design, tree-ring chronologies, PostgreSQL/PostGIS, Procedural Language/PostgreSQLBakalárska práca sa zaoberá návrhom priestorovej databázy letokruhových chronológií. Teoretická časť práce sa venuje databázovým systémom, princípom ukladania priestorových dát v relačných databázach, existujúcim databázam letokruhových chronológií, ale aj základným princípom dendrochronológie. V ďalšej časti práce sú popísané poskytnuté dendrochronologické dáta, ktoré sú používané v metodickej časti práce. Metodická časť popisuje dátové požiadavky pre tvorenú databázu, postup jej návrhu a implementáciu v rámci PostgreSQL/PostGIS. Následne sa venuje tvorbe funkcií tvorených v procedurálnom rozšírení SQL, ktoré slúžia na zefektívnenie vkladu dát a neskôr je popisovaná tvorba SQL príkazu slúžiaceho ako dátový filter. Hlavným výsledkom práce je vytvorená priestorová databáza spĺňajúca dátové aj funkčné požiadavky, ktorá je naplnená poskytnutými dátami a pripojiteľná ku GIS. Záverom práce je zhrnutie dosiahnutých výsledkov a stručný popis prínosu práce v prebiehajúcom výskumnom projekte. Kľúčové slová: priestorová databáza, návrh databázy, letokruhové chronológie, PostgreSQL/PostGIS, Procedural Language/PostgreSQL
Keywords:
letokruhové chronologie; návrh struktury databáze; PostGIS; PostgreSQL; Prostorové databáze
Institution: Charles University Faculties (theses)
(web)
Document availability information: Available in the Charles University Digital Repository. Original record: http://hdl.handle.net/20.500.11956/126084